How GPS Navigation Works: A Technical Explanation

So, how does GPS navigation work its magic? In simple terms, it relies on a network of satellites orbiting the Earth, transmitting signals that are received by your phone’s GPS chip. By processing this data, your phone can calculate your precise location, velocity, and time, providing you with turn-by-turn directions and other navigation features.

While the concept may seem complex, the principles behind GPS navigation are based on straightforward geometry and physics. By understanding the mechanics of GPS navigation, users can better appreciate the technology and its limitations, ultimately enhancing their overall navigation experience.

Addressing Common Curiosities and Misconceptions

There are many common misconceptions surrounding GPS navigation, ranging from concerns about battery drain to myths about its accuracy. In reality, modern GPS navigation systems are designed to be energy-efficient, with many devices capable of lasting several hours on a single charge even with GPS enabled.

Regarding accuracy, GPS navigation systems have reached an impressive level of precision, with many devices able to provide location data accurate to within a few meters. However, it is essential to note that accuracy can be affected by factors such as physical obstructions, satellite signal strength, and device quality.
